Daniel L. Poland to become executive vice president and chief supply chain officer
January 11, 2022
Campbell Soup Company announced the appointment of Daniel L. Poland as executive vice president and chief supply chain officer, effective Jan. 10, 2022. Poland succeeds Bob Furbee who informed the company of his intent to retire after 38 years of service. Furbee will remain with Campbell until April 2022 and work with Poland to ensure a smooth transition.

Adam Grogan to become president of Greenleaf Foods, SPC
January 7, 2022
Maple Leaf Foods Inc., a North American producer of high-quality, sustainable protein, announced that Adam Grogan will assume the role of president of its wholly-owned subsidiary, Greenleaf Foods, SPC ("Greenleaf"), effective January 31, 2022.
Seasoned food executive Mary K. Wagner, Ph.D. becomes first independent board member of BlueNalu
January 6, 2022
BlueNalu, a leading innovative food company developing a variety of seafood products directly from fish cells, announced the appointment of Mary K. Wagner, Ph.D. as its first independent board director. She brings an extensive and diverse range of senior leadership experiences in the food industry to BlueNalu and currently serves on the boards of both public and private food businesses.
